Hebrew

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]
Root
י־ס־ף (y-s-p)

Third-person singular jussive of הוֹסִיף (hosíf, to add), thus meaning “may he add”.

Pronunciation

[edit]

Proper noun

[edit]

יוֹסֵף (yoséfm

  1. Joseph (Biblical figure)
  2. a male given name, Yosef, equivalent to English Joseph
